Muddy, dark brown beer with decent, short-lived carbonation builds a beige, silky, tightly packed head that barely reaches one finger and settles gradually down to neat lace ring.
The nose receives easily recognizeable cocoa beans, a bit of coffee with soft cream, brown syrupy malt and a bite of chocolate. The taste receptors are pleased with the taste of cocoa beans and a small dollop of coffee that are accompanied by sweet brown malt and some milk chocolate.
The body is light to light-medium. The beer finishes with slightly bitter brown malt that has gained a faint roasted tang, chocolate cookie, coffee with cream and raw cocoa powder. The aftertaste disappears relatively hastily from the mouth.
The mouthfeel is relatively light, nicely soft and smooth as well as a bit lip-glueing. It's also somewhat desserty.
